On July 17, at the National Military Training Center 4 (Hanoi), the first general training session of the parade and marching groups took place in preparation for the 80th anniversary of the August Revolution and National Day September 2 (mission A80). Notably, the general training session had the participation of military equipment groups such as tanks, missiles...
